RECOM launches new catalogue for full power

(Business News, 09 May 2008 )

RECOM has launched its new 2008 catalogue and optimized its product range which offers a wide range of innovative products ranging from R-78 switching regulators with 97% efficiency to a completely new series of LED drivers. With more than 6,000 different products covering the whole range of low power conversion - AC/DC-converters, DC/DC converters, switching regulators and LED-Drivers - RECOM now has one of the most comprehensive portfolios on the market.

The power supply specialist, with its headquarters in Germany and technical support centers in New York, Singapore and Austria, offers a one-stop-shop solution in power conversion. The new simplified catalogue is especially targeted at the demands of design engineers, providing comprehensive yet uncluttered information about the RECOM product lines.

In combination with RECOM’s different regional Websites (i.e., www.recom-electronic.com; www.recomasia.com or www.recom-power.com for US), the company offers a worldwide network of distributors and representatives. Besides strengthening its portfolio, RECOM has also significantly widened its worldwide distribution network.
